Doesn't come out here in the States until tomorrow, yet I found the collector's edition at Best Buy on Saturday! Came with a sticker and a fold-out poster of the album artwork.

Gotta say, this is an impressive album. I really, really disliked their last two albums - the concept was boring, there wasn't enough fast music, the guitars sounded extremely thin and weak, and everything was just... dull, in my opinion. Glorious Burden wasn't all that great either.

But Dystopia... the music is finally heavy again, and it's fast - back to the Iced Earth I knew ages ago! Stu Block is an incredible vocalist, a friend of mine described him as a 'vocal chameleon' and he totally is - he sounds exactly like Ripper Owens when he hits the high notes, but the rest of the time he sounds like Matt Barlow! If I didn't know Barlow had left the band, I could've easily been fooled into thinking he was still singing for them.

The title track is great, the song Anthem is good too, and there's a song on the special edition I have called Soylent Green that's not bad either :lol: Needs some more spins to digest the rest of the music but wow, I'm impressed - and thank god, too, because I had nearly lost all hope in the band!

Iced Earth will be recording a show for CD/DVD in Cyprus in June

In addition, Freddie Vidales has left the band (with plans to retire from music) and been replaced by Luke Appleton (current bassist in FuryUK, who toured with Iced Earth around Europe)
